On the 11th hour of the 11th day of the 11th month of 1918, the major hostilities of World War I formally ended. This historic date has been memorialized around the world. Whether recognized as Armistice Day, Remembrance Day or Veterans Day, Nov. 11 serves as a solemn reminder.

It has been said that we rise by lifting others, and Hanes, America’s No. 1 apparel label and flagship brand of HanesBrands (NYSE: HBI), is encouraging all Americans to support the homeless by participating in its national sock drive during the holiday season. Hanes today announced that it will donate 200,000 pairs of socks to The Salvation Army and is expanding this year’s effort by coordinating the collection of new socks at 160 HanesBrands Outlet stores across the country.
